HX08 CWF is a 2008 Piaggio Ape in Black with a 422c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 4 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 2008 Piaggio Ape models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.0% with a typical mileage of 4,256 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Piaggio Ape fails its MOT is windscreen washer provides insufficient washer liquid, accounting for 22 recorded failures. If you're considering buying HX08 CWF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Piaggio Ape typ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 18 years old, this Piaggio Ape is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
